|
网络传输分层结构是现代通信技术的基石,它如同精密运转的钟表内部齿轮,将复杂的数据传输过程分解为多个层次,每一层各司其职又协同合作,共同确保了信息能够在全球网络中准确、高效地流动? 理解这一结构,是理解互联网乃至整个数字世界运作逻辑的关键? 网络分层的思想源于对复杂系统的模块化处理。 早期的网络通信协议往往庞大而臃肿,任何微小的改动都可能牵一发而动全身! 为了解决这一问题,国际标准化组织(ISO)提出了著名的开放系统互连参考模型(OSI七层模型),它将通信过程抽象为物理层、数据链路层、网络层、传输层、会话层、表示层和应用层七个层次;  每一层都建立在下一层服务之上,并为上一层提供服务,层与层之间通过清晰的接口进行交互。 这种设计使得每一层的技术可以独立演进,大大增强了系统的灵活性和可维护性。  尽管OSI模型在理论上非常完备,但实际中广泛使用的是更为简洁实用的TCP/IP四层模型。 该模型将OSI的上三层合并为应用层,形成了网络接口层、网际层、传输层和应用层的结构。  其中,网络接口层负责在物理媒介上传输原始比特流。 网际层(以IP协议为核心)负责将数据包从源主机路由到目标主机,实现跨网络的寻址和转发! 传输层(主要包括TCP和UDP协议)负责端到端的通信,确保数据的可靠传输或高效传送!  应用层则包含了诸如HTTP、FTP、SMTP等具体应用协议,直接面向用户提供服务。 分层结构的优势显而易见。 首先,它降低了设计的复杂性; 工程师可以专注于某一层的功能实现,而无需通盘考虑所有细节; 例如,开发电子邮件应用的程序员只需遵循SMTP等应用层协议,无需关心数据是如何被分割成包、又如何通过光纤或无线信号传输的! 其次,它促进了技术的标准化和互操作性! 只要遵循统一的接口规范,不同厂商生产的网络设备(如路由器、交换机)和软件就能够无缝协作,这是互联网得以全球普及的前提?  最后,分层带来了强大的灵活性。  当底层物理技术从以太网升级到光纤,或无线技术从4G演进到5G时,上层的应用软件几乎无需修改即可享受更快的速度。  然而,分层也并非没有代价。 严格的层级划分有时会导致效率的损失,例如某些功能可能在多层中重复出现(如差错检测)。 此外,随着网络应用的日益复杂,一些新的需求(如服务质量保证、深度安全检测)往往需要跨层优化,这在一定程度上挑战了严格的层级边界?  展望未来,随着物联网、边缘计算和5G/6G技术的发展,网络传输的需求变得更加多样化和苛刻。  未来的网络架构可能在保留分层核心思想的同时,引入更灵活的“服务化”或“切片化”理念,根据不同的应用场景动态组织网络功能。 但无论如何演进,分层结构所蕴含的“分而治之、高内聚低耦合”的工程智慧,将继续照亮网络技术前行的道路? 它不仅是数据字节有序流动的蓝图,更是人类应对复杂系统时理性与智慧的结晶!
|